I really enjoyed "The Stalker Part II" and fans of suspense cinema will no doubt find this a worthwhile watch. I also urge you to watch “The Stalker” first installment, which was terrifying as well. “The Stalker Part II," is a suspenseful sequel that is nail biting from start to finish. Director Michelle Lewis masterfully takes us on a tightly paced, thrilling nightmare of terror, picking up where the first installment left off and plunging us deeper into the psychopath that terrorizes a family. Among the capable ensemble cast, Jessie Bell who plays the matriarch Wendy is a stand out, who found herself incarcerated and grappled with the aftermath of the Hamilton family's ordeal. Sean Michael Nugent is outstanding and memorable as the titled character, his portrayal reminiscent of Jack Nicholson in one of my favorite horror flicks, “The Shining”. With his crazy eyes and evil grin, Sean Michael Nugent brings heft and urgency to the role, keeping viewers mesmerized with a fantastic roller-coaster ride of plot twists and turns.

This second entry in the Stalker series completely raises the bar. While the first film had its strengths, this follow-up is tighter, bolder, and far more compelling. The story is full of twists and tension, keeping me glued to the screen the entire time. There wasn’t a dull moment—just when I thought I knew where things were going, the film would throw in a sharp turn that kept the suspense alive. Visually, it's a step up as well. The cinematography is striking, and the production quality gives everything a polished, cinematic feel. The performances are strong across the board, but the chemistry between the two detectives really anchors the film. Sean Nugent’s performance during the dream sequence was unforgettable—raw, intense, and borderline disturbing in the best way. I also loved how the filmmakers wove in themes of PTSD to tie the story back to the first film. It added a surprising layer of depth and made the emotional stakes feel real without slowing down the pace. There are also just the right touches of humor to balance the darker moments, which gave the film a nice rhythm. This isn't just a solid sequel—it’s a fully realized thriller that hits all the right notes.
